Ask a questionAbout Katherine B. Francis
My passion is design, the minute I laid eyes on this building I knew I had to have it. So much character, I even took my daughter and showed it to her, telling her I was going to buy it and what did she think?. I then thought I would have a tea shop there, as my Mother and Father are Irish. It seemed like it could be a family affair. Shortly after I purchased the building Charles Nelson who was the State Historic Architect suggested to me that I get on the Stillwater Heritage Commission, as they needed my help. Charles and I had worked on other projects in the past together. WA Frost was one and other Twin City projects. I dove into the second floor of Excelsior building opening up all the rooms that had been separated by doors and exposing brick where it would make a difference. Then the worst happened, my Mother died and my whole world feel apart. My passion was gone and the building restoration stopped. I was lost without my Mom's encouragement. So the building was rented out, left to it's own. In the last two years, I have restored woodwork and had all but one room floors restored, new windows, painting and the fun part decorating. I had a new roof put on with a new outside rooftop deck, a new deck outside master suite, complete new kitchen, all materials out of recycled historic items. New Furnace/Central Air. Tuckpointing of Exterior. It takes you back to the late 1800's with flair of the 2000's. I am so proud of the restoration at Excelsior Escape. It's fun, open and a great piece of living history. It is centrally locating on Main Street and it's a contributing part of Historic Stillwater.
